Job Description:

Support a program control team responsible for developing methodologies, tools, and models to help predict and optimize the schedules associated with current and future space system architectures including spacecraft, ground stations, and various support systems. This role involves working both independently and collaboratively on schedule data analysis using the Critical Path Method.
